Recap - Lakers Defeat Oklahoma City 129-120

The Lakers got a 40-point performance from LeBron James as Los Angeles handed Oklahoma City a 129-120 defeat on Saturday at Paycom Center.

Los Angeles got 26 points from Anthony Davis and another 21 points from Rui Hachimura. Austin Reaves contributed 9 assists, while Anthony Davis cleaned the glass with 11 rebounds.

The Thunder got a 34-point performance from Shai Gilgeous-Alexander, who was supported by 28 points from Jalen Williams. Shai Gilgeous-Alexander had 7 assists in a losing cause for Oklahoma City, while Chet Holmgren grabbed 10 rebounds.
